Description
Lovely Semi Detached property located to the sought after village of Blyth. With extended accommodation arranged over two floors including a lounge, spacious dining room, kitchen and lean-to style conservatory on the ground floor. The first floor having two bedrooms, bathroom and potential on the landing to create a small single bedroom. With off street parking, front and rear gardens and a garage. Blyth has a range of local pubs and eateries, a village shop, reputable primary school and doctors surgery. The village has countryside on the doorstep and ideal commuter links via the A1 motorway network and Retford Train Station.

Ground Floor Accommodation

Lounge 13' 10" max x 11' 6" + Bay ( 4.22m max x 3.51m + Bay )
This lovely lounge features a front facing double glazed bay window overlooking the garden. Coving to the ceiling, wall lights and a central heating radiator. French doors open up to the spacious dining room beyond making an ideal space for entertaining.

Dining Room 17' 1" max x 11' 1" ( 5.21m max x 3.38m )
Generous size dining room with a feature fireplace. Central heating radiator, side facing double glazed window, wall lights, dado rail and coving to the ceiling.

Kitchen 10' 3" x 10' 2" ( 3.12m x 3.10m )
Fitted with a good range of wall, base and display units with complimentary worktops and inset 1 1/2 bowl sink with drainer. Benefitting from integrated oven and hob, fridge/freezer and having space for a washing machine. Rear facing double glazed window, main entrance door, central heating radiator, tiled floor and splash backs.

Conservatory
Lean to style with sliding patio door, facing the beautiful back garden.

First Floor Accommodation

Landing
The landing has potential to make a third bedroom. Featuring a rear and side facing double glazed window, central heating radiator, coving to the ceiling and loft access.

Bedroom One 13' 8" max x 7' 11" plus wardrobe ( 4.17m max x 2.41m plus wardrobe )
Double bedroom featuring a built in wardrobe and dresser. A front facing double glazed bay window, central heating radiator and coving on the ceilings.

Bedroom Two 11' 4" x 9' 5" plus wardrobe ( 3.45m x 2.87m plus wardrobe )
Second bedroom having a rear facing double glazed window, coving to the ceiling, and built in wardrobes/drawers.

Bathroom
Bathroom fitted with a bath, wc and a wash hand basin. Side facing double glazed window, central heating radiator, recessed lights and tiling to the walls.

External
Walled front garden with double wrought iron gates and ample parking to the driveway.
The rear garden is of a good size with a large variety of plants shrubs and trees plus a spacious lawn area. Features include a raised pond, garden shed and green house. In addition, there is hedging to the perimeters which offer extra privacy.

Garage 19' 11" x 10' 5" ( 6.07m x 3.17m )
Situated at the top of the driveway with vehicular access and side courtesy door.
